#bb1953 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bb1953 is composed of 73.3% red, 9.8%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86.6% magenta, 55.6%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 338.5 degrees, a saturation of 76.4% and a lightness of 41.6%. #bb1953 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ff32a6 with #770000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#bb1953 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bb1953 has RGB values of R:187, G:25,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.87, Y:0.56,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12261715.

Shades and Tints of #bb1953
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0206 is the darkest color, while #fffc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#bb1953
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#726268 is the less saturated color, while #d3014c is the most saturated one.
